projects
/
soc.git
/ history
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
first
⋅
prev
⋅
next
Be more precise when using a one-bit constant
[soc.git]
/
src
/
2021-03-20
Luke Kenneth Casso...
more pseudocode in TestIssuer
tree
|
commitdiff
2021-03-20
Luke Kenneth Casso...
move radixmmu to unit test format
tree
|
commitdiff
2021-03-20
Luke Kenneth Casso...
add harmless code and commented-out pseudocode for...
tree
|
commitdiff
2021-03-20
Luke Kenneth Casso...
sort out predicate zeroing in ISACaller
tree
|
commitdiff
2021-03-20
Luke Kenneth Casso...
attempting to add src/dest-zeroing to ISACaller
tree
|
commitdiff
2021-03-19
Luke Kenneth Casso...
more comments for TestIssuer when adding predication
tree
|
commitdiff
2021-03-19
Tobias Platen
testcase for _get_pgtable_addr
tree
|
commitdiff
2021-03-19
Luke Kenneth Casso...
decode predicate src/dest zeroing in SVP64RMModeDecode
tree
|
commitdiff
2021-03-19
Luke Kenneth Casso...
comments for TestIssuer get_predint and get_predcr
tree
|
commitdiff
2021-03-19
Luke Kenneth Casso...
add more pieces of predication reading puzzle to TestIssuer
tree
|
commitdiff
2021-03-19
Luke Kenneth Casso...
cleanup TestIssuer (comments)
tree
|
commitdiff
2021-03-19
Luke Kenneth Casso...
spelling
tree
|
commitdiff
2021-03-19
Luke Kenneth Casso...
code-shuffle in TestIssuer, split out setting up periph...
tree
|
commitdiff
2021-03-19
Luke Kenneth Casso...
move duplicated code to a function in TestIssuer
tree
|
commitdiff
2021-03-18
Luke Kenneth Casso...
more hint/comments
tree
|
commitdiff
2021-03-18
Luke Kenneth Casso...
comments / code-shuffle
tree
|
commitdiff
2021-03-18
Luke Kenneth Casso...
update TestIssuer comments
tree
|
commitdiff
2021-03-18
Luke Kenneth Casso...
add comments on most likely place to put predicate...
tree
|
commitdiff
2021-03-18
Luke Kenneth Casso...
comments TestIssuer, add a stub FSM
tree
|
commitdiff
2021-03-18
Luke Kenneth Casso...
add MSR PR read in RADIXMMU ISACaller
tree
|
commitdiff
2021-03-18
Luke Kenneth Casso...
re-add auto-generated file simplev.py to gitignore
tree
|
commitdiff
2021-03-18
Luke Kenneth Casso...
experiment in radixmmu with returning addr_next (and...
tree
|
commitdiff
2021-03-18
Luke Kenneth Casso...
add sv_out2 to PowerDecode and PowerDecoder2
tree
|
commitdiff
2021-03-18
Luke Kenneth Casso...
cross-reference to bug #619
tree
|
commitdiff
2021-03-18
Luke Kenneth Casso...
add auto-generation of out2 column in SVP64RM
tree
|
commitdiff
2021-03-18
Luke Kenneth Casso...
add option to move RS in CSV file reading, for compatib...
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
correct comments
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
re-enable SVP64 ISACaller predicate tests
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
add ascii graphic for extsw svp64 operation
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
add more explanatory comments
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
add twin-predicated extsw SVP64 ISACaller unit test
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
add SVP64 dststep incrementing in PowerDecoder2, Testis...
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
add CR-based predication to ISACaller
tree
|
commitdiff
2021-03-17
Tobias Platen
cleanup raduxmmu._walk_tree
tree
|
commitdiff
2021-03-17
Tobias Platen
create iterative mmu lookup loop
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
add SVP64 INT-style predication to ISACaller
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
add predication SVP64 unit test
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
add predication read ports (CR and INT)
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
whoops shift has to be done at same bitwidth
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
split out new_lookup function
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
link up SVP64 RM Mode decoding into PowerDecoder2
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
add priv and mode to RADIXMMU
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
add instr_fetch mode to ISACaller Mem and RADIXMMU
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
whitespace
tree
|
commitdiff
2021-03-17
Luke Kenneth Casso...
add in SVP64 RM Mode decoder
tree
|
commitdiff
2021-03-16
Tobias Platen
radixmmu: detect badtree
tree
|
commitdiff
2021-03-16
Tobias Platen
add valid, leaf to loop
tree
|
commitdiff
2021-03-16
Cesar Strauss
Use symbolic values for subfields and bits
tree
|
commitdiff
2021-03-16
Cesar Strauss
Add subfield and bit definitions for the SVP64 RM mode...
tree
|
commitdiff
2021-03-16
Cesar Strauss
Define and initialise the mode variable, to be used...
tree
|
commitdiff
2021-03-16
Cesar Strauss
Rename class so it does not clash with the enum
tree
|
commitdiff
2021-03-15
Cesar Strauss
Fix import
tree
|
commitdiff
2021-03-15
Tobias Platen
add rpte bitfields valid and leaf
tree
|
commitdiff
2021-03-14
Luke Kenneth Casso...
remove "sv." and replace with "sv" in all SVP64Asm
tree
|
commitdiff
2021-03-14
Luke Kenneth Casso...
remove "sv." and replace with "sv" in all SVP64Asm
tree
|
commitdiff
2021-03-14
Cesar Strauss
Activate the VL==0 loop with any SVP64 prefix whatsoever
tree
|
commitdiff
2021-03-13
Luke Kenneth Casso...
add setvl unit test assertions, add 2nd test
tree
|
commitdiff
2021-03-13
Luke Kenneth Casso...
get first revision setvl operational in ISACaller
tree
|
commitdiff
2021-03-13
Luke Kenneth Casso...
add setvl-to-long converter in SVP64Asm (sigh)
tree
|
commitdiff
2021-03-13
Luke Kenneth Casso...
add setvl unit test
tree
|
commitdiff
2021-03-13
Luke Kenneth Casso...
include SVSTATE in namespace, passing to ISACaller
tree
|
commitdiff
2021-03-12
Jacob Lifshay
add setvl to decoder
tree
|
commitdiff
2021-03-12
Jacob Lifshay
autoformat code
tree
|
commitdiff
2021-03-12
Luke Kenneth Casso...
add OP_SETVL to MicrOp in power_enums.py
tree
|
commitdiff
2021-03-12
Luke Kenneth Casso...
add ability to set and distinguish RT=0 (RT_OR_ZERO...
tree
|
commitdiff
2021-03-12
Luke Kenneth Casso...
use PowerDecoder2.loop_continue instead of no_out_vec
tree
|
commitdiff
2021-03-12
Luke Kenneth Casso...
remove old code
tree
|
commitdiff
2021-03-12
Luke Kenneth Casso...
remove old code
tree
|
commitdiff
2021-03-12
Luke Kenneth Casso...
remove old code
tree
|
commitdiff
2021-03-12
Luke Kenneth Casso...
add more sophisticated checking of whether SVP64 loop...
tree
|
commitdiff
2021-03-12
Luke Kenneth Casso...
**FOR NOW** LD/ST relies on detection of twin-predicati...
tree
|
commitdiff
2021-03-12
Luke Kenneth Casso...
decoding of svp64 reg by name has to occur after immedi...
tree
|
commitdiff
2021-03-12
Jacob Lifshay
add forgotten PO (primary opcode) field to DecodeFields
tree
|
commitdiff
2021-03-11
Cesar Strauss
Bring a few test cases from test_caller_64.py
tree
|
commitdiff
2021-03-11
Cesar Strauss
Test case for two successive SV instructions
tree
|
commitdiff
2021-03-11
Luke Kenneth Casso...
add link of RA_OR_ZERO SVP64 detection
tree
|
commitdiff
2021-03-11
Luke Kenneth Casso...
add detection of whether *full* 7-bit of RA is zero...
tree
|
commitdiff
2021-03-11
Luke Kenneth Casso...
add in SVP64 LD/ST basic test for ISACaller
tree
|
commitdiff
2021-03-11
Luke Kenneth Casso...
whoops sort out when svstate not active in ISACaller
tree
|
commitdiff
2021-03-11
Luke Kenneth Casso...
whoops PIDR is defined as 32-bits in SPRs.csv (and...
tree
|
commitdiff
2021-03-11
Luke Kenneth Casso...
add understanding of LDST immediates to SVP64ASM
tree
|
commitdiff
2021-03-11
Tobias Platen
fix runtime error
tree
|
commitdiff
2021-03-10
Tobias Platen
radix: reading first page table entry
tree
|
commitdiff
2021-03-10
Luke Kenneth Casso...
add walk_tree arguments it needs
tree
|
commitdiff
2021-03-09
Luke Kenneth Casso...
fix address must convert to SelectableInt
tree
|
commitdiff
2021-03-09
Luke Kenneth Casso...
call decode_ptre on address to obtain shift, mbits...
tree
|
commitdiff
2021-03-09
Tobias Platen
whitespace
tree
|
commitdiff
2021-03-09
Tobias Platen
RADIX: call self._walk_tree in ld and st
tree
|
commitdiff
2021-03-09
Luke Kenneth Casso...
debug radix mmu ISACaller
tree
|
commitdiff
2021-03-09
Tobias Platen
comment out broken spr code
tree
|
commitdiff
2021-03-09
Tobias Platen
_walk_tree: access sprs
tree
|
commitdiff
2021-03-09
Luke Kenneth Casso...
create first check_perms RADIX ISACaller function
tree
|
commitdiff
2021-03-09
Luke Kenneth Casso...
move Mem class out of ISACaller
tree
|
commitdiff
2021-03-09
Luke Kenneth Casso...
cleanup imports
tree
|
commitdiff
2021-03-09
Luke Kenneth Casso...
move ISACaller RADIX MMU class to separate module
tree
|
commitdiff
2021-03-09
Luke Kenneth Casso...
add pgtable and pte calculation to RADIX ISACaller
tree
|
commitdiff
2021-03-09
Cesar Strauss
Enable VL==0 vector instruction skip test case
tree
|
commitdiff
2021-03-09
Cesar Strauss
Add some extra debug traces to the GTKWave document
tree
|
commitdiff
2021-03-09
Cesar Strauss
Create a new signal for the Simulator to wait on
tree
|
commitdiff
2021-03-08
Luke Kenneth Casso...
start adding _get_prtable_addr
tree
|
commitdiff
next